Le code Morse est une méthode de transmission des informations textuelles comme une série de tons de marche / arrêt, voyants ou clics directement compréhensible par un auditeur qualifié ou un observateur sans équipement spécial.
Chaque caractère (lettre ou chiffre) est représenté par une séquence unique de points et de tirets.
Le code morse est un code de longueur variable, mais la longueur maximum d’un personnage est 5 points ou des tirets.
L’appareil est construit sur ATTiny13 micro.
Il s’agit d’un simple pour construire l’appareil, j’ai utilisé le temps firse pour transmettre un message de Noël, puis j’ai utilisé dans une partie avec des amis:)
Mon implémentation de code morse repose sur l’idée de Ethan Blanton (http://kb8ojh.net/msp430/morse_encoding.html). N’importe quel caractère peut être rapresented en 8 bit, avec 0 comme remplissage bit, 1 pour le bit de démarrage, bit restant pour le caractère de code morse (0 pour dit [..] 1 pour dah[-]).
J’ai étendu le code morse à l’aide de deux led, un pour impression vid ou dah, l’autre pour l’espace lettre, mot et chaîne.
Il y a également un bouton pour sélectionner la chaîne à émettre.
Chaînes à afficher sont stockées dans Attiny EEprom.
Schémas est attaché, est très simple, besoin seulement quelques résistances et deux conduit, et il fonctionne avec une pile 3v, comme cr2032.
Code source disponible ici : avr_morse_led_1.1.zip